Town Hall bosses are a real hit in the Gay community in London’s East End after getting onto a list of Britain’s most diverse employers.
The highest new ‘local government’ entry on the UK Stonewall Index is Tower Hamlets Council, coming in at No 30 on the list of 100 best organisations for lesbian, gay and bi-sexual staff.
“Stamping out discrimination and empowering our residents are responsibilities we take seriously,” Tower Hamlets Mayor John Biggs said. “We’ll continue promoting a positive approach to equalities.”
The council has been praised for “diversity” in the community in October’s LGTB awards at the Town Hall.
Tower Hamlets Homes, the housing wing of the local authority, did even better—making it to the top five in the Stonewall Index chart for the second year running.
The list is compiled from submissions to the Workplace Equality Index, a benchmark used by employers to create inclusive workplaces.
